Nail to nail art insurance is a type of insurance that provides coverage for nail technicians who specialize in nail art. This insurance is essential for anyone in the nail art industry, as it protects both the technician and the client in case of any unforeseen accidents or incidents.
One of the key benefits of nail to nail art insurance is that it provides liability coverage. This means that if a client were to experience an injury or damage to their nails as a result of the nail technician’s work, the insurance would cover any associated medical expenses or repair costs. This can be particularly important in the nail art industry, where intricate designs and techniques are used that can sometimes pose a risk to the client.
In addition to liability coverage, nail to nail art insurance also typically covers professional indemnity. This means that if a client were to make a claim against the nail technician for negligence or malpractice, the insurance would cover any legal fees or compensation that may need to be paid out. This can provide peace of mind for both the technician and the client, knowing that they are protected in the event of any disputes or complaints.
Another important aspect of nail to nail art insurance is that it often includes coverage for equipment and supplies. In the nail art industry, technicians rely on a wide range of tools and products to create their designs. If any of these were to be damaged or stolen, the insurance would cover the cost of replacing them. This can be crucial for a nail technician’s business, as it ensures that they can continue to provide their services without interruption.
Furthermore, nail to nail art insurance can also provide coverage for business interruption. This means that if a technician were to experience a sudden loss of income due to unforeseen circumstances, such as a natural disaster or a fire in their salon, the insurance would compensate them for any lost earnings. This can help to safeguard a technician’s livelihood and ensure that they are able to continue operating their business in the long term.
